Potential IPF Treatment, an LOXL2 Inhibitor, Showing Benefits in Preclinical Work

Synairgen, plc, recently reported positive data from its ongoing work, in partnership with Pharmaxis, to develop a lysyl oxidase type 2 enzyme (LOXL2) inhibitor as a new treatment for idiopathic pulmonary fibrosis (IPF). The results were derived from experiments in an in vitro model of IPF, using patients’ lung cells,…
